The food delivery industry has experienced rapid expansion in recent years, driven by growing demand for convenient on-demand services. With platforms such as Uber Eats and DoorDash revolutionizing the way consumers order food, the emphasis has shifted to developing innovative food delivery apps. These apps provide customers the ability to order food from their preferred restaurants and have it delivered directly to their location. For businesses, the task is to leverage technology to enhance delivery operations and ensure a smooth customer experience.

Restaurant Delivery Partnerships: A Winning Strategy


Eateries are increasingly forming collaborations with delivery platforms to expand their customer reach. These agreements help restaurants cater to a wider customer base while minimizing the obstacles of managing their own delivery operations. The effectiveness of such collaborations hinges upon technology integration, which enhances the app usability and enhances the user satisfaction. Through these collaborations, restaurants can boost brand loyalty and make sure that they remain relevant in a saturated market.

The Impact of the Pandemic on Food Delivery Services


The COVID-19 pandemic has had a profound impact on the food delivery industry, accelerating its expansion as consumers opted for on-demand apps due to social distancing guidelines. The change has emphasized the necessity of technological evolution in the food industry, with restaurants rapidly adopting e-commerce platforms and delivery apps. As the world adjusts to new routines, food delivery businesses must continue innovating to meet evolving consumer demands and secure business growth.
